Special Weather Statement for Lincoln, NC

Posted: 01 Apr 2012 03:20 PM PDT

Issued by The National Weather Service
Greenville-Spartanburg, SC
5:59 pm EDT, Sun., Apr. 1, 2012

… STRONG THUNDERSTORMS WILL AFFECT CLEVELAND… EASTERN RUTHERFORD… LINCOLN… SOUTHERN BURKE… SOUTHERN CATAWBA AND WESTERN GASTON COUNTIES THROUGH 645 PM EDT…

AT 555 PM EDT… NATIONAL WEATHER SERVICE DOPPLER RADAR INDICATED STRONG THUNDERSTORMS ALONG A LINE EXTENDING FROM 7 MILES NORTHWEST OF CASAR TO CHESNEE… MOVING EAST AT 40 MPH.

THESE STORMS WILL BE NEAR… POLKVILLE… BOILING SPRINGS NC… LAWNDALE… VALE… EARL… CHERRYVILLE…

WIND GUSTS OF 40 TO 50 MPH ARE EXPECTED WITH THESE STORMS.

Panetta Credits Peleliu for Helping Reach Turning Point in War

Posted: 30 Mar 2012 10:00 PM PDT

The United States has reached a turning point after a decade of conflict, but must stay the course to continue to face down terrorism and other threats, Defense Secretary Leon E. Panetta said during a visit to the USS Peleliu off the coast of Camp Pendleton, Calif.
